2014-07-17 5 views
0

локальных/visvabharati/archive.html/типа/уведомлениепереписано гиперссылка на HTAccess

это мой url.I хочет переписать в виде

LOCALHOST/visvabharati/archive.php ? Тип = уведомление

Пожалуйста, помогите мне, как бы Б.Е. HTAccess

В настоящее время с помощью

AddHandler x-mapp-php5 .php 
Options +FollowSymLinks 
RewriteEngine on 
#RewriteBase/
DirectoryIndex index.php?url_key=index [T=application/x-httpd-php,L] 
RewriteRule ^([^/]*).html$ /index.php?url_key=$1 [T=application/x-httpd-php,L] 
RewriteRule ^([^/]*).html-([^/]*)$ /index.php?url_key=$1&id=$2 [T=application/x-httpd-php,L] 

Но его предоставление 500. Пожалуйста, помогите мне разобраться С уважением

+0

Почему вы используете 'T = application/x-httpd-php' где угодно? – anubhava

+0

hii Благодарим вас за ответ им очень новый в этом отношении первый раз, сделав это, я тоже его удалил, но ничего не изменилось еще 500, можете ли вы направить меня. – user3713999

ответ

0

Этот код здесь будет делать это на одной странице.

RewriteRule ^localhost/visvabharati/archive.html/(.+)/(.+) localhost/visvabharati/archive.php?$1=$2 

Если вам нужно сделать это для нескольких страниц, это должно сработать.

RewriteRule ^localhost/visvabharati/(.+).html/(.+)/(.+) localhost/visvabharati/$1.php?$2=$3 
+0

RewriteEngine на RewriteRule^localhost/visvabharati /(.+). Html /(.+)/(.+) localhost/visvabharati/$ 1.php? $ 2 = $ 3 Я поставил ваш код вот так, но все же 404, спасибо вам во всяком случае, для доброго ответа – user3713999

0

Предполагая, что visvabharati является каталогом.

Место это в /visvabharati/.htaccess:

RewriteEngine on 
RewriteBase /visvabharati/ 

RewriteRule ^([^.]+)\.html/([^/]+)/([^/]+)/?$ $1.php?$2=$3 [L,QSA,NC] 

Также вам нужно удалить все код, указанный в вашем вопросе.

+0

после использования этого не давая 404, но теперь его не удается загрузить страницу вообще и первую целевую страницу .... не удалось получить сеанс, большое вам спасибо за ваш добрый ответ. – user3713999

+0

Если нет 404 и что вы подразумеваете под тем, что не можете загрузить? Какой URL-адрес вы использовали для тестирования? Это 'http: // localhost /' или 'http: // localhost/visvabharati /'? – anubhava

Смежные вопросы